Novra S-300 Noaaport Receiver


This week I installed a new Noaaport satellite receiver. This is the Novra S300. If the current plan holds, next week NOAA will begin the testing/dual illumination period of the DVB-S2 signal. The switch from DVB to DVB-S2 was the reason a new receiver was needed. (The current receiver had only been in use for about a year). Anyway the unit arrived early Tuesday morning and I had it swapped out and running in less than 15 minutes. Seems to be working well with the DVB signal and looking forward to seeing how it works with the DVB-S2 signal.
